Resources on Starting a Nonprofit in different states in the US: Beginning a Nonprofit Frequently Asked Questions 1. Exactly how much does it set you back to start a not-for-profit organization? You can begin a not-for-profit organization with an investment of $750 at a bare minimum and it can go as high as $2000.

The length of time does it require to establish a not-for-profit? Depending on the state that you remain in, having Articles of Unification approved by the state government might use up to a few weeks. As soon as that's done, you'll have to make an application for acknowledgment of its 501(c)( 3) status by the Irs.

With the 1023-EZ kind, the processing time is commonly 2-3 weeks. Can you be an LLC and a nonprofit? LLC can exist as a not-for-profit minimal obligation firm, however, it needs to be completely possessed by a single tax-exempt not-for-profit company.

What is the distinction between a structure and a nonprofit? Structures are usually funded by a household or a company entity, yet nonprofits are moneyed with their incomes as well as fundraising. Foundations typically take the cash they began with, invest it, as well as then disperse the cash made from those financial investments.

Whereas, the additional money a nonprofit makes are used as running prices to fund the organization's objective. This isn't always true in the situation of a structure. 6. Is it hard to start a nonprofit company? A nonprofit is a business, but starting it can be quite extreme, requiring time, clarity, and money.

Although there are several actions to start a nonprofit, the obstacles to entry are fairly couple of. 7. Do nonprofits pay tax obligations? Nonprofits are excluded from government revenue tax obligations under area 501(C) of the internal revenue service. However, there are specific circumstances where they might need to make payments. As an example, if your nonprofit gains any type of earnings from unassociated activities, it will owe income taxes on that particular quantity.

Twenty-eight different kinds of nonprofit organizations are recognized by the tax legislation. But by far the most common sort of nonprofits are Area 501(c)( 3) companies; (Area 501(c)( 3) is the part of the tax code that authorizes such nonprofits). These are nonprofits whose mission is charitable, spiritual, educational, or scientific. Section 501(c)( 3) organization have one massive advantage over all other nonprofits: contributions made to them are tax obligation insurance deductible by the contributor.

This classification is important due to the fact that exclusive foundations undergo rigorous operating regulations as well as laws that do not relate to public charities. Deductibility of contributions to an exclusive structure is much more restricted stripe for nonprofits than for a public charity, as well as exclusive foundations are subject to excise tax obligations that are not enforced on public charities.

The bottom line is that personal foundations get a lot even worse tax obligation therapy than public charities. The primary difference between personal structures and public charities is where they get their financial backing. A personal foundation is normally managed by an individual, family, or corporation, and also gets the majority of its income from a couple of benefactors as well as investments-- an example is go to this web-site the Expense and Melinda Gates Structure.

Many structures just offer money to various other nonprofits. As a sensible matter, you require at the very least $1 million to start a private structure; otherwise, it's not worth the problem and cost.

Various other nonprofits are not so fortunate. The internal revenue service at first presumes that they are personal foundations. A new 501(c)( 3) organization will certainly be identified as a public charity (not an exclusive structure) when it applies for tax-exempt condition if it can show that it fairly can be anticipated to be openly sustained.

The smart Trick of Non Profit Organizations List That Nobody is Discussing

If the internal revenue service classifies the nonprofit as a public charity, it maintains this standing for its initial five years, despite the public support it really obtains throughout this time. Beginning with the nonprofit's sixth tax obligation year, it needs to reveal that it fulfills the public assistance test, which is based on the top nonprofits support it receives during the present year and also previous 4 years.



If a nonprofit passes the test, the internal revenue service will certainly remain to monitor its public charity condition after the first 5 years by needing that a completed Schedule A be submitted annually.
